Mobile Club Repair Cart

Ed Mitchell Technologies introduces its Mobile Club Repair Cart. A Custom Club Repair Box is built on a Cushman Hauler Pro 1200 gas utility cart. It provides space to re-grip, adjust loft and lie angles on full swing clubs & putters, check swing weights, club lengths & shaft frequency and to re-shaft any golf club. A complete set of clubs can be built from this unit.

Grips are stored in the bins provided and it has a reservoir tank to collect excess grip solution to prevent damage to the grass on practice tee. A power inverter is installed to run motors for shaft preparation, a shaft frequency meter and it has a USB port to charge your digital devices.


“The Mobile Club Repair Cart solves the space problem that prevents many golf clubs from building a club repair shop”, states Ed Mitchell, PGA, founder of Ed Mitchell Technologies. “It is perfect for use during golf lessons and club fittings to improve your golfer’s ball flight results. Park it on the practice range during the day and store it in the cart barn at night.”

The Custom Club Repair Box is fabricated from steel with diamond plate aluminum doors on three sides. This attractive design is self-contained for all necessary machines and tools with predetermined mounting positions for all your equipment.  It is powered to run 110v electrical motors. A custom water repellant cover is available to keep your tools dry and clean.

The Mobile Club Repair Cart is available as a complete unit of if you already have a utility vehicle the Custom Club Repair Box can be purchased separately. Contact Ed Mitchell for details.

About Ed Mitchell Technologies

Ed Mitchell Technologies is the developer of the Mobile Club Repair Cart. The industries most versatile mobile vehicle that allows repairing, fitting and building golf clubs on a practice range or at a putting green. It is also great for entrepreneurs who want to travel from club to club providing repair service.

Ed Mitchell Technologies also conducts the golf industry’s premier golf clinics on club performance. Attendees learn about the importance of club performance on ball flight, understanding how golf club alternations improves scoring and learn instruction/club fitting methods incorporating club & ball performance data.

Club/FACTS golf clinics are designed and taught by a recognized golf club performance industry expert for fellow industry professionals. Ed Mitchell has decades of practical experience as a PGA golf professional, golf instructor, club fitter, club repair technician in golf course and retail markets, in tour vans on PGA & LPGA tours and as an inventor and manufacturer of club performance and repair machines and tools.
